I’ve kicked around buying some kind of water softener setup for car washes but I’m trying it without. I bought a TDS meter and tried it in my house which has a softener. The water showed a higher reading after the softener than the raw water coming in the house. I actually almost called the softener company but then I read online where that’s normal. The softener removes the “undesirable “ hardness but doesn’t lower the TDS. The water is better as far as spotting goes with the rural water we have now than the well water we used to have.
Our well water is high in calcium and lime. At least the sprinklers don't stain the house orange as with iron.

I have a soap cannon, works great. Mine goes on the pressure washer.
I also built a filter for a spot free rinse. A 4" x 20" water softener cartridge, then a 4" x 20" deionizing cartridge.
